We just had an issue with our failover unit reloading. In perusing the logs there were a number of %ASA-3-210007: LU allocate xlate failed, errors prior to the reload. These units had just had their OS upgraded to fix a DOS issue a few weeks ago. I have not seen the error since it reloaded. However, I was asked to report the issue just in case it is a bug in the new version of the OS.Two units in failover.
